以下是有赞交易系统的订单状态生命周期图,便于有意向入职有赞交易团队的同学了解 😃
画出这张图,感觉就像写了一段优雅的代码。看来,程序猿的画工还是要努力提升的。 😃
画出这幅图,是动了一点脑筋的。 要在一张图上展现订单状态变化的全周期,有一点经验:
- 仔细安排节点位置,避免多个流程的线条交叉。如果实在无法避免交叉,保持尽量清晰亦可。
- 不同意义的实体用不同的形状。比如状态,用圆角矩形; 导致状态发生变化的操作,用平角矩形。
- 不同流程的区分。通用流程,用实线; 特定流程,用短横线; 不改变订单状态的操作,用虚线。 这样,有错落之美。
- 对齐,距离。 对齐和距离,是产生美感的两大要件。适当的运用,能够让最终的图形更加简洁清晰。